In the volatile economic climate of February 2026, the term "Recession-Proof" has taken on a more nuanced meaning. As we navigate a "K-shaped" recovery where AI-driven tech continues to pull ahead while traditional sectors face pressure from sticky inflation and higher-for-longer interest rates, the professional allocator is returning to Defensive Sovereignty.
A recession-proof stock isn't one that never drops; it is one that possesses the Pricing Power, Balance Sheet Strength, and Essential Utility to survive when the consumer pulls back. In 2026, the benchmark for safety is a combination of low $Beta$ (volatility relative to the market) and a consistent dividend payout ratio.
Here are the 10 best recession-proof stocks to anchor your portfolio this year.
1. Walmart (WMT): The Value King
Walmart is the ultimate "Counter-Cyclical" play. When the economy slows, middle-to-high income households "trade down" to Walmart for groceries and essentials.
The 2026 Advantage: Walmart’s aggressive push into Automated Logistics and its high-margin advertising business (Walmart Connect) have allowed it to maintain margins even as labor costs rise.
Key Metric: It has demonstrated a near-perfect correlation with rising consumer price sensitivity.
2. Johnson & Johnson (JNJ): The Healthcare Anchor
Healthcare is non-discretionary; patients do not "postpone" cancer treatments or life-saving surgeries during a downturn.
The 2026 Advantage: Following its strategic split from its consumer health division (Kenvue), JNJ is now a pure-play Pharmaceutical and MedTech powerhouse.
The Moat: It is a "Dividend King" with over 60 years of consecutive increases, providing a psychological and financial floor for investors.
3. NextEra Energy (NEE): The Utility Powerhouse
Utilities provide the "Base Layer" of modern life. NextEra is the world’s largest renewable energy company, combining the safety of a regulated utility with the growth of green energy.
The 2026 Advantage: As AI data centers demand unprecedented amounts of 24/7 "Clean Energy," NextEra’s massive backlog of solar and storage projects provides a guaranteed revenue stream for the next decade.
4. Procter & Gamble (PG): The Daily Essential
People still need to wash their clothes and brush their teeth in a recession. P&G owns the most dominant brands in the household category (Tide, Gillette, Crest).
The 2026 Advantage: P&G has mastered "Brand Elasticity," allowing it to raise prices to offset inflation without losing significant market share.
5. PepsiCo (PEP): The Snack and Sip Defense
While consumers might skip a luxury steakhouse dinner, they rarely skip the small indulgence of a soda or a bag of snacks.
The 2026 Advantage: Pepsi’s Frito-Lay division is a cash-flow machine. In 2026, the company’s focus on "Right-Sized" packaging has allowed it to capture different price points for a cash-strapped public.
6. UnitedHealth Group (UNH): The Managed Care Titan
As the largest private health insurer in the U.S., UnitedHealth is functionally integrated into the American economy.
The 2026 Advantage: Through its Optum division, UNH is also a massive healthcare provider and data analytics firm. This vertical integration allows them to control costs better than any competitor.
7. Waste Management (WM): The "Constant" Utility
Trash collection is a necessity, not a luxury. Waste Management operates a near-monopoly in many regions with massive barriers to entry (landfills).
The 2026 Advantage: WM is increasingly turning its landfills into Renewable Natural Gas (RNG) plants, creating a high-margin energy revenue stream out of literal garbage.
8. McDonald’s (MCD): The Global Real Estate Play
McDonald’s is often safer than its peers because it is essentially a Real Estate Investment Trust (REIT) disguised as a burger chain.
The 2026 Advantage: It remains the "Default Value Option" for global families. Its digital loyalty app now accounts for over 40% of sales, giving it unprecedented data on consumer behavior.
9. Costco Wholesale (COST): The Subscription Fortress
Costco's membership model creates a "Sticky" revenue stream that is independent of how many rotisserie chickens they sell.
The 2026 Advantage: High-income consumers treat Costco as an essential bulk-buy destination during inflationary periods. Their 90%+ membership renewal rate is the highest in the industry.
10. Verizon (VZ): The Digital Utility
In 2026, high-speed internet and cellular connectivity are viewed as a "First-Tier" utility, often prioritized by consumers over car payments or dining out.
The 2026 Advantage: Verizon’s focus on 5G Private Networks for industrial use provides a stable, B2B revenue layer that is more resilient than the consumer churn market.
